Kundalini
Kundalini is often spoken of as serpent power, rising energy, or spiritual fire.
For some, it arrives through years of practice.
For others, it begins unexpectedly - through crisis, loss, trauma, deep devotion, or a moment life cannot explain.
What follows can feel powerful, beautiful, confusing, or deeply destabilizing.
Sensitivity changes.
The nervous system feels unfamiliar.
Old structures begin to fall away.
Not every intense spiritual experience is kundalini.
And not every awakening should be romanticized.
This space approaches kundalini with both reverence and caution.
Here, we explore kundalini awakening as a process of transformation - one that affects body, mind, emotions, relationships, and the deeper structure of identity itself.
The goal is not intensity.
It is integration.
Awakening without grounding can become suffering.
Real spiritual work asks for both.
